Art and Design Technology Teacher
Secondary School – Chorley
Start Date: 23rd February
Contract: Fixed term until the end of the academic year
Location: Chorley, Lancashire
We are working in partnership with a supportive and forward-thinking secondary school in Chorley to appoint a creative and skilled Art and Design Technology Teacher to join their team from 23rd February until the end of the academic year.
This role is ideal for a passionate teacher who can inspire students across Art and DT, fostering creativity, technical skills and confidence in a practical learning environment.
The Role
The successful candidate will:
- Teach Art and Design Technology across Key Stages 3 and 4
- Plan and deliver engaging, creative and practical lessons
- Assess, monitor and report on pupil progress
- Maintain a safe, organised and stimulating classroom/workshop environment
- Support students of mixed abilities to achieve their full potential
- Contribute positively to the wider school community
The Ideal Candidate Will:
- Hold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ent
- Have experience teaching Art and/or Design Technology in a secondary setting
- Demonstrate strong classroom and behaviour management skills
- Be enthusiastic, adaptable and committed to high-quality teaching
- Have a strong understanding of curriculum requirements and health & safety in practical subjects
- Be committed to safeguarding and student wellbeing
The School Offers:
- A welcoming and supportive staff team
- Well-resourced Art and DT facilities
- Engaged and motivated pupils
- A positive and inclusive working environment
- Ongoing support throughout the placement
